Question
Pipe A can fill a tank in 8 hours, while pipe B can
empty the full tank in 12 hours. Both pipes are opened together. After how many hours should pipe B be closed so that the tank is exactly full in 10 hours?Solution
Let B be open for x hours. Rates: A = 1/8 per h, B = −1/12 per h Work done = x(1/8 − 1/12) + (10 − x)(1/8) = 1 1/8 − 1/12 = 1/24 So: x/24 + (10 − x)/8 = 1 Multiply 24: x + 3(10 − x) = 24 x + 30 − 3x = 24 −2x = −6 → x = 3 So B should be closed after 3 hours.
